WSP has an opportunity for an experienced Senior Public Health Engineer in London. You will have the chance to work on some of the most exciting and prestigious projects in the world.

A little more about your role...

  • Responsible for the delivery of Public Health and Fire Suppression systems designs at all RIBA Stages on projects.
  • Supervising the completion of detailed designs and supervise the work of others in this function.
  • Considering the feasibility of the project specific to the discipline and lead the overall feasibility study for the project.
  • Taking responsibility for and directing others in the production of detailed and performance specification for the discipline subject to review by colleagues prior to issue.
  • Producing detailed equipment schedules for issue with the discipline specific designs.
  • Regularly briefing the project team and ensuring contracts/letters of intent are in place for all projects before work begins.
  • Reviewing the detailed design programme and ensuring that sufficient resource is available to complete the works.
  • Leading the completion and regular amendment to the project 'Cost to Complete' (CTC) and monitoring the work of the project engineers.
